Abstract
Abstract — Heart disease is among the most common serious conditions in dogs and cats, and a murmur heard on auscultation is one of its earliest signs. Sonus Health is a smartphone-based screening system that analyses an auscultation recording of roughly thirty seconds — captured by an owner at home or by a vet in clinic — and returns a tiered result within moments. Evaluated on 322 veterinary-labelled recordings under standard out-of-fold cross-validation, the high-confidence tier (30% of cases) reaches 95.9% accuracy, with 94.0% sensitivity and 97.9% specificity. Uncertain cases are prospectively routed to veterinary review rather than guessed at. Results are stable across cross-validation protocols, a held-out test split, and multiple random seeds.

Inside the paper
How the result is evaluated
- 322 real-world recordings
- Dogs and cats, captured on consumer smartphones at home and in clinic, each labelled through a layered veterinary review — no idealised lab re-captures.
- Validated four ways
- Standard and group-aware (animal-level) cross-validation, a held-out test split, and a seed-stability analysis, all reported with bootstrap confidence intervals.
- A calibrated two-model pipeline
- A frequency-domain model sensitive to subtle murmur structure, combined with a summary-statistic model robust to noise, placed on a common probability scale before they vote.
- Benchmarked against the literature
- A qualitative side-by-side with published canine and feline screening systems, with the differences in species, device, and labelling spelled out.
